Edges rubbed, ink note and ink stamps on endpapers, paper remains adhered to rear paste-down endpaper. 1940 Hard Cover. xviii, 206 pp. Fold-out sketch map of Fly River Expedition follow text. Endpapers illustrated with map of New Guinea. Illustrated with black-and-white photographs. CONTENTS: Early Discoveries; Preparation at Daru; Reconnaissance Flights; Palmer Junction Camp; Move to Black River Black River Camp; Retreat from the Mountains; Rafting; Oroville and Daviumbu; Lake Daviumbu; Daviumbu to Sturt Island; Sturt Island; To Gaima--At Gaima; Tarara; Daru; Index.
